The Beaches

LʼAmetlla de Mar boasts some of the most beautiful and untouched beaches in Spain. From secluded coves with crystal clear waters to wide sandy stretches, there is a beach to suit every taste. One of the highlights is the famous Cala Bon Caponet, a pristine cove surrounded by cliffs that offer breathtaking views. Other must-visit beaches include Cala Llobeta and Cala Calafató, both of which are perfect for sunbathing, swimming, and snorkeling.

Explore the Fishing Ports

LʼAmetlla de Mar is still a working fishing town, and its ports are bustling with activity. Take a stroll along the harbor and witness the fishermen returning with their catches of the day. For an authentic experience, visit the Lonja, the local fish market, where you can see the freshest seafood being sold and even buy some to cook at your accommodation or enjoy in one of the waterfront restaurants. Make sure to try the local specialty, “caldereta de peix,” a delicious seafood stew that is a staple of the region.

FAQs

Can I reach LʼAmetlla de Mar by public transportation?

Yes, LʼAmetlla de Mar is easily accessible by public transportation. There is a train station in the town center with regular connections to Barcelona and other major cities in the region.

What is the best time to visit LʼAmetlla de Mar?

The best time to visit LʼAmetlla de Mar is during the late spring and early autumn when the weather is pleasant, and the town is not crowded with tourists. This time of year allows you to fully enjoy the beaches and outdoor activities without the summer crowds.

What other attractions are there near LʼAmetlla de Mar?

LʼAmetlla de Mar is located in close proximity to various attractions. You can visit PortAventura World, a popular theme park in Salou, or explore the nearby Ebro Delta Natural Park, known for its diverse bird species and stunning landscapes. The historic city of Tarragona is also just a short drive away, offering Roman ruins and a charming old town.
